Why yiou air purifier filter replacement matters for indoor air quality

Replacing filters on your Yiou air purifier is a foundational step in maintaining clean indoor air, reducing common irritants like dust, pollen, and pet dander. When you delay replacement, the purifier struggles to trap particles, which can lead to reduced airflow, louder operation, and diminished effectiveness against odors. The Air Purifier Info Team emphasizes that timely filter changes are one of the most effective, simplest ways to sustain high indoor air quality. In practice, a fresh yiou air purifier filter replacement keeps filtration efficiency high and helps you maintain allergen control in rooms where you spend the most time. Always consult your model’s manual for compatibility notes, but the general rule of thumb is to replace filters when the indicator signals or every 6–12 months in typical use. Compatibility and fit: understanding sizes and seals

A proper seal around the filter is critical to prevent unfiltered air from short-circuiting through the purifier. Ill-fitting filters can reduce airflow and create uneven filtration. Before installation, inspect the filter slot for any debris, seals, or gasket wear. If you notice cracks or deformities, replace the seals or the entire housing if recommended by the manufacturer. In many Yiou models, the filter slides into a cartridge bay and is held by a retaining tab or magnetic frame; make sure the filter lies flat and the edges align with the slot. If the edges are visibly crooked, remove and reseat the filter to ensure an airtight fit.

Tips:

  • Check the gasket for cracks and replace if needed.
  • Avoid forcing a larger filter into a smaller slot.
  • After installation, perform a quick visual check to confirm a flush fit.

Troubleshooting and common mistakes to avoid

Common mistakes during yiou air purifier filter replacement include using an incompatible filter, not reseating the filter properly, and skipping the reset procedure if required by the model. Such missteps can cause reduced airflow, sensor errors, and false readings from the unit’s LED indicators. If you notice an unusual odor after replacement, recheck the seal and ensure there’s no loose debris in the housing. If the purifier won’t restart after a replacement, unplug the unit for at least 60 seconds, then plug it back in and power on. If problems persist, consult the manufacturer’s guide or reach out to a professional. Air Purifier Info notes that using an improper filter is a common reason for subpar performance.

Steps

Estimated time: 25-45 minutes

  1. 1

    Power down and unplug the purifier

    Ensure the device is completely powered off and unplugged before touching any internal components. This prevents electric shock and protects sensitive filtration areas from accidental movement while you work.

    Tip: If the unit is mounted or plugged behind furniture, move it gently without stressing cords or connectors.
  2. 2

    Open the filter access

    Depending on the model, remove a front panel, lift a top cover, or slide out a filter drawer. Do not force panels; use the designated release latches or screws as instructed by the manual.

    Tip: Take a quick photo of the housing before removal to aid reassembly.
  3. 3

    Remove the old filter

    Gently pull the used filter straight out to avoid tearing the media. If the filter is dusty, wear gloves and avoid shaking it near your face.

    Tip: Inspect the filter’s frame for tears—if damaged, replace the entire cartridge.
  4. 4

    Insert the new Yiou filter

    Align the new cartridge with the guides and slide it into the chamber until the edges seat flush. Ensure any airflow arrows match the unit’s orientation.

    Tip: Do not force the filter; if it won’t seat, remove and reinsert with gentler pressure.
  5. 5

    Reset indicators and test

    If your model requires a reset after filter replacement, perform it per the user manual. Power on the device and run a quick test cycle to verify airflow and LED indicators.

    Tip: Listen for normal fan noise and look for steady, unobstructed airflow.
  6. 6

    Clean up and finalize

    Wipe down the exterior and replace any panels. Dispose of the old filter in accordance with local regulations and keep your replacement filters in a cool, dry place.

    Tip: Note the date of replacement in a log to track future changes.

Can I clean a Yiou filter instead of replacing it?

Most purifier filters are designed to be disposable. Cleaning can damage the media and reduce filtration efficiency. Always replace with a compatible new filter when performance wanes.
